XDC Network Crossing From Retail Asset To Institutional Access

A major shift highlighted by Hepburn involves regulated custody and institutional access. Anchorage Digital now provides custody support connected to XDC Network, opening doors that were previously closed. Institutional capital rarely engages without regulated infrastructure, and that hurdle appears to be clearing.

Additional exposure has emerged through structured products outside the US, including ETPs listed in Switzerland under regulatory oversight. Those products signal more than curiosity. They show confidence in liquidity, compliance, and long term viability. The pathway mirrors earlier developments seen with XRP, where derivatives and trading vehicles preceded deeper institutional participation.

Institutions Moving From Exposure To Network Participation

Another layer to the story involves validators. Hepburn points out that some Swiss institutions are exploring direct participation as validators on XDC Network. This step matters because it requires infrastructure deployment, operational learning, and ongoing commitment. Institutions rarely take on such roles unless they see durable economic incentives and future client demand.

The shift from passive exposure to active network involvement suggests confidence beyond short term price movements. Validator participation reflects belief in the system itself, not just its market value.

XDC Network has also moved into live banking environments. An AI powered bank in the UAE has integrated XDC at a production level. This type of deployment differs sharply from pilot programs or limited tests. Real transactions in regulated jurisdictions signal functional trust.

Trade finance and real world asset activity continue to build as well. Tokenized funds, real estate initiatives, and cross border payment corridors show economic movement across the network. Utility has expanded while XDC price remains anchored near historical lows.
